The longest and largest nerve in your body is your sciatic nerve. It begins in your lower back as five smaller nerves joining together and extends to the following areas: pelvis, thigh, knee, calf, ankle, foot and toes.
Sciatica Pain
When the sciatic nerve becomes inflamed, the pain becomes very intense and causes a condition called sciatica. The pain follows the path of your nerves – it can go down the back of your legs or thighs or radiate into your back. It can cause severe leg pain or back pain.
